"The Bandar Idol" is a 2013 Team Fantomen story, written by Tony De Paul, with art by César Spadari.
Plot summary
The Phantom receive a magazine from an unknown sender; an old Bandar idol is to go for sale at an auction house in New York. Linked to the idol is the story of a visit of three monks from Southeast Asia to the Deep Woods in the 16th century and the lost continent of Mu.
